Latest Patents

One of Jung-hyeon Lee's latest patents is a method of forming fine patterns of semiconductor devices using a double patterning process that employs acid diffusion. This innovative technique involves the formation of multiple first mask patterns on a substrate, followed by the application of a capping film that includes an acid source. The acid diffuses into a second mask layer, allowing for the creation of precise second mask patterns. This method enhances the accuracy and efficiency of semiconductor manufacturing.
